Oh, yes, I totally forgot that. I was in first grade when they had all the school children go to the cafeteria to eat a sugar cube impregnated with the live polio vaccine. This effectively put an end to the huge number of people coming down with what used to be called infantile paralysis (remember FDR). We had no vaccines against measles, mumps, rubella (so-called German measles), or against chicken pox, hepatiis, and a number of other diseases. The only antibiotics I know of that were available then were penicillin and the sulfa drugs, and many people were allergic to them. Asthma could not be treated well, and non-aspirin over the counter pain killers had not been invented yet. Those of us who lived then can now see the things we were lacking, but of course, they weren't something we could even identify.

I used to be amazed that my grandparents went from horse and buggy to rocket ships during their lifetimes, but I am seeing great changes happening today that rival those in importance. I think every era has the promise of being the best of times. It's all in the way you see things.

Bubonic plague and scarlet fever are caused by bacteria, not viruses, and are fought with antibiotics. Scarlet fever is a rash caused by a strep infection, often strep throat, and can weaken the heart. There is no vaccination that I know of against bacterial infections.
